Why You're Seeing "AMZN MKTP BR" on Your Bank Statement

What Is "AMZN MKTP BR" on My Bank Statement?
The AMZN MKTP BR charge on your bank statement comes from Amazon Brazil, the Brazilian branch of the global Amazon marketplace. This descriptor appears when you've made a purchase through Amazon's Brazilian platform, whether it's a physical product, digital item, or marketplace transaction fulfilled by a third-party seller. The 'MKTP' portion stands for 'Marketplace,' and 'BR' identifies the transaction as originating from Brazil. If you see this charge, it typically reflects a recent shopping order placed on Amazon.com.br.
Amazon uses abbreviated billing descriptors like AMZN MKTP BR to standardize how transactions appear across banking systems worldwide, as full company names often exceed character limits set by payment processors. The 'BR' country code is appended specifically to distinguish Brazilian marketplace transactions from Amazon purchases made in other countries, such as the US (AMZN MKTP US) or UK (AMZN MKTP UK). This shorthand format is consistent across all of Amazon's global marketplaces and is the official descriptor registered with card networks like Visa and Mastercard.

Is AMZN MKTP BR Legitimate or Fraud?
The charge labeled AMZN MKTP BR on your bank or credit card statement is almost always a legitimate transaction from Amazon's Brazilian Marketplace (Amazon.com.br). This descriptor appears when a purchase is made through Amazon Brazil, either directly or via a third-party seller operating on the Brazilian platform.
Common reasons you might see AMZN MKTP BR on your statement include:
- A purchase made on Amazon.com.br for physical or digital goods
- A subscription or recurring service billed through Amazon Brazil
- A family member or authorized user shopping on Amazon's Brazilian platform
- An Amazon Prime Brazil membership renewal charge
However, if you do not recognize the charge and have no connection to Amazon Brazil, it is worth investigating further, as fraudulent use of your card details is always a possibility.
How to Verify the AMZN MKTP BR Charge
- 1
Log into your Amazon Brazil account
Visit Amazon.com.br and sign in. Navigate to 'Meus Pedidos' (My Orders) to check if any recent purchases match the AMZN MKTP BR charge amount and date.
- 2
Search your email for receipts
Search your inbox for emails from Amazon.com.br or noreply@amazon.com.br. AMZN MKTP BR transactions typically trigger an order confirmation email with a matching total.
- 3
Check household members
Ask family members or anyone who shares your payment method if they made a purchase through Amazon Brazil that would appear as AMZN MKTP BR on your statement.
- 4
Review your Amazon subscriptions
Log into Amazon.com.br and check 'Assinaturas e AssociaΓ§Γ΅es' (Subscriptions & Memberships) to see if an active subscription is generating the AMZN MKTP BR charge.
- 5
Contact your bank
If none of the above steps clarify the AMZN MKTP BR charge, call the number on the back of your card and ask your bank for the exact merchant details tied to the transaction.
How to Dispute an AMZN MKTP BR Charge
- 1
Act within 60 days
Most banks require disputes to be filed within 60 days of the statement date. Act quickly if you believe the AMZN MKTP BR charge is unauthorized or incorrect.
- 2
Contact AMZN MKTP BR directly first
Reach out to Amazon Brazil customer service at Amazon.com.br/ajuda. Explain the issue β Amazon can often issue a refund faster than a formal bank dispute for AMZN MKTP BR charges.
- 3
File a chargeback with your bank
If Amazon Brazil does not resolve the issue, contact your bank or card issuer and formally dispute the AMZN MKTP BR transaction. Provide your order details or lack thereof as evidence.
- 4
Request a new card
If the AMZN MKTP BR charge is confirmed fraudulent, ask your bank to cancel your compromised card and issue a new one to prevent further unauthorized transactions.
